首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

手机域名纠错系统怎么解决

手机域名纠错系统是一种用于纠正用户在输入网址时可能出现的拼写错误或格式错误的系统。这种系统通常应用于移动浏览器、搜索引擎或其他需要用户输入网址的应用中。

基础概念

手机域名纠错系统通过以下几个步骤工作:

  1. 输入检测:系统首先检测用户输入的网址。
  2. 错误识别:系统识别输入中的拼写错误或格式错误。
  3. 纠正建议:系统提供可能的正确网址作为纠正建议。
  4. 用户选择:用户可以选择系统提供的纠正建议,或者继续使用原始输入。

优势

  • 提高用户体验:减少用户因输入错误而无法访问目标网站的情况。
  • 增加访问量:即使用户输入错误,系统也能引导他们访问正确的网站,增加网站的访问量。
  • 减少搜索引擎的负担:用户更可能直接访问目标网站,而不是通过搜索引擎查找。

类型

  • 基于规则的纠错系统:使用预定义的规则来识别和纠正错误。
  • 基于统计的纠错系统:利用大量数据训练模型,识别和纠正错误。
  • 混合纠错系统:结合规则和统计方法,提高纠错的准确性和效率。

应用场景

  • 移动浏览器:用户在输入网址时提供纠错建议。
  • 搜索引擎:在用户搜索时提供网站链接的纠错建议。
  • 输入法:在用户输入网址时提供实时纠错建议。

常见问题及解决方法

问题1:系统无法识别某些复杂的拼写错误。

  • 原因:可能是系统的纠错算法不够强大,无法处理复杂的拼写错误。
  • 解决方法:升级纠错算法,增加更多的训练数据,提高系统的识别能力。

问题2:系统提供的纠正建议不准确。

  • 原因:可能是系统的训练数据不足或存在偏差。
  • 解决方法:增加更多的训练数据,确保数据的多样性和准确性。

问题3:系统响应速度慢。

  • 原因:可能是系统在处理大量请求时性能不足。
  • 解决方法:优化系统架构,增加服务器资源,提高系统的处理能力。

示例代码

以下是一个简单的基于规则的纠错系统示例,使用Python实现:

代码语言:txt
复制
import re

def correct_domain(domain):
    # 常见的拼写错误替换规则
    corrections = {
        'gogle': 'google',
        'facebok': 'facebook',
        'twiiter': 'twitter'
    }
    
    # 替换拼写错误
    for wrong, correct in corrections.items():
        domain = re.sub(r'\b' + wrong + r'\b', correct, domain, flags=re.IGNORECASE)
    
    return domain

# 测试
input_domain = "www.googl.com"
corrected_domain = correct_domain(input_domain)
print(f"Input: {input_domain}, Corrected: {corrected_domain}")

参考链接

通过以上方法,可以有效解决手机域名纠错系统中的常见问题,提高系统的准确性和用户体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

域名污染是什么玩意?怎么解决

首先什么叫做域名污染,有很多同学并不知道域名污染是什么回事。 下面教叫你如何看~ 怎么验证是否遭遇DNS污染? 咱们拿域名www.vipba.cc 测试!...2.再输入 nslookup wangyueblog.com(你的域名) 你的DNS服务器IP ,来查看是否能解析。...域名遭遇DNS污染怎么解决? 1.更换DNS解析服务器。...目前有很多第三方网站提供DNS解析服务,不少都是免费的,国内也有免费提供DNS解析服务的,使用第三方DNS服务可以部分解决问题,比如望月正在使用的DNSpod服务,就是国内还算比较稳定的DNS解析服务。...注意事项一:在换用第三方解析服务的时候,应该先到DNSPOD之类的解析服务商那里将域名解析,过几个小时再到godaddy之类的域名注册商那里去修改DNS服务器,这样可以避免博客出现因解析时间造成的空白期

9.4K00

什么是域名解析 域名解析错误怎么解决

很多站长在建站的时候,都要对域名进行解析,其实域名解析就是把域名绑定到主机上的过程,那么什么是域名解析?域名解析错误怎么解决呢?...今天,小编就为大家介绍一下关于域名解析以及解决域名解析错误的一些方法。 什么是域名解析? 域名解析就是把我们的域名转换成一个IP地址,把我们的域名通过解析后绑定到相应的IP地址的主机上。...那么我们该怎么判断域名解析是否出现故障呢?...image.png 域名解析错误怎么解决? 那么对于域名解析出现故障,域名解析错误怎么解决呢?...以上就是小编为大家介绍的关于域名解析错误怎么解决的相关信息。如果确定是因为域名解析出现了故障,我们可以用更改本地DNS服务器,和清除DNS的缓存信息的方法来解决

48.5K30
  • 域名被墙是什么意思?被墙域名怎么解决

    被墙域名怎么解决?下面小编就为大家来详细介绍一下。 image.png 域名被墙是什么意思? 很多网站在使用过程中都会出现各种问题的,其中关于域名的问题就有很多,域名被墙是什么意思呢?...首先大家要知道我国的互联网为了保护信息安全会在计算机中设置相应的防火墙,域名被墙就是这个域名被防火墙拦截了,会出现域名被墙的原因有很多,这也是为了保护网站的安全。 被墙域名怎么解决?...发生被墙域名这种情况还是比较常见的,那么被墙域名怎么解决呢?...首先大家需要检查一下网站的内容有没有问题,是否违反了相关规定,网站出现一些违规的东西可能就会出现域名被墙,其次就是域名解析方面,大家可以重新将网站的域名解析到特定的地址。...相信大家看了上面的文章内容已经知道被墙域名怎么解决了,域名使用过程中出现的问题还是蛮多的,所以大家如果想要域名正常使用的话,还是需要好好做网站的内容,不要去触犯我国的法律规范。

    11.8K40

    电脑域名解析错误怎么解决 如何选择好的域名

    如果大家真的遇到了这种情况,不要慌,下面就给大家讲讲电脑域名解析错误怎么解决? image.png 电脑域名解析错误怎么解决 电脑域名解析错误怎么解决?...很多人不知道域名解析是个什么过程,简单来说,就是域名转换到IP地址的一个过程,而这种过程是需要DNS服务完成。如果电脑提示域名解析错误,很有可能就是DNS出错。...解决方法如下:网络共享中心——更改设配器设置——找到要链接的网络,右击属性——Internet协议版本4——勾选“自动获得IP地址”和“自动获得DNS服务器地址”,这样就解决域名解析错误的问题啦!...能注册拼音简写的就拼音简写,不能就需要多用心想,如何让这个域名既能让用户记住又能凸显形象。 以上就是关于电脑域名解析错误怎么解决的教程,希望能帮助到大家,域名也相当于一个IP地址。...很多小白都不了解域名的重要性,以为域名用什么都一样,只要用户能访问就没什么问题,即使用户不注意看域名,不懂域名,大家要做到精益求精。

    12.1K30

    cdn域名是如何解析的?cdn域名取消了怎么解决

    不同的网站使用的域名种类也是比较多的,不同的域名注重的方向也不一样,cdn域名就是现在使用非常普遍的域名种类之一,很多互联网行业的网站都会使用cdn域名,cdn域名的作用是很大的,那么cdn域名是如何解析的...cdn域名取消了怎么解决? image.png cdn域名是如何解析的?...cdn域名的解析方法还是比较简单的,一般来说需要大家前往域名注册的服务商进行相关操作,在用户中心就可以进行域名解析了,当然也可以借助一些域名解析工具。 cdn域名取消了怎么解决?...很多使用cdn域名的网站平时会遇到各种问题,不同的问题解决方法也是不一样的,很多人会问cdn域名取消了怎么解决?...相信大家看了上面的文章内容已经知道cdn域名取消了怎么解决了,cdn域名使用还是比较普遍的,这种域名的性价比也比较高,平时使用的过程中出现问题也比较容易解决

    5.3K30

    手机连不上wifi是怎么回事呢?应该怎么解决

    在现代社会手机已经变成了一个“万能工具箱”,既可以接打电话、收发短信,还可以预订机票、预定酒店、线下支付等,可以说有了手机就有了一切,但是在使用手机的过程中,我们经常遇到一些问题,比如手机连接不上wifi...下面为大家介绍手机连不上wifi是怎么回事以及如何解决。 image.png 手机连不上wifi是怎么回事 1、路由器有故障。...3、手机无线网卡出现问题。手机连接wifi都是依靠手机中的无线网卡进行的,如果无线网卡损坏则无法连接wifi。...怎么解决手机连不上wifi 上一部分介绍了手机连不上wifi是怎么回事,手机连不上wifi可能是路由器及手机的问题,所以应该用下面的方法进行解决:首先,可以关闭手机的wifi,然后再重新打开,等待系统自动分配...以上为大家介绍了手机连不上wifi是怎么回事,手机连不上wifi有很多方面的原因,可以逐一排查、解决问题,就能够让手机成功连接wifi了。自己实在不知道怎么操作的话,可以咨询一些专业的维修人员。

    11.6K50

    ping域名提示 unknown host,ping IP正常,nslookup解析域名正常怎么解决

    问题现象: ping 域名时不能解析域名,ping IP可以,初步看机器网络是正常的 root@BJ-CentOS7 ~ # ping baidu.com ping: unknown host baidu.com...于是测试发现nslookup可以正常解析域名,DNS配置是没错的 root@BJ-CentOS7 ~ # nslookup baidu.com Server: 183.60.83.19 Address...hosts 配置项: files 表示使用 /etc/hosts 和 /etc/network 配置文件 dns 表示使用 /etc/resolv.conf 文件中的 DNS解析地址 nis 表示查询NIS系统的配置信息...,而 ping 程序在没有在 /etc/nsswitch.conf 中的 hosts: dns 选项,所以无法解析 /etc/hosts 文件中不存在的解析记录 解决方案: 在 /etc/nsswitch.conf...文件的 hosts 配置项中添加 dns 选项,则可以使用 /etc/resolv.conf 中的 DNS 服务器解析域名,再次测试,可以正常解析域名了 root@BJ-CentOS7 ~ # grep

    9.4K10

    域名系统DNS用来解析_网页域名解析错误怎么

    目录 1、DNS 2、域名系统DNS 的作用 3、域名的层级关系 4、DNS域名解析过程 递归查询 迭代查询 5、高速缓存 6、DNS相关面试问题 1、DNS DNS(Domain Name...System)是域名系统的英文缩写,是一种组织成域层次结构的计算机和网络服务命名系统,用于 TCP/IP 网络。...2、域名系统DNS 的作用 通常我们有两种方式识别主机:通过主机名或者 IP 地址。人们喜欢便于记忆的主机名表示,而路由器则喜欢定长的、有着层次结构的 IP 地址。...为了满足这些不同的偏好,我们就需要一种能够进行主机名到IP 地址转换的目录服务,域名系统作为将域名和 IP 地址相互映射的一个分布式数据库,能够使人更方便地访问互联网。...域名系统既不规定一个域名需要包含多少个下级域名,也不规定每一级的域名代表什么意思。

    20.8K10

    域名重定向怎么解决?如何避免出现此类问题?

    一开始人们会感觉非常陌生,在咨询专业人员后能找到优质的解决方案,这是常见的网站问题,今天就来具体介绍域名重定向怎么解决?一起来学习了解。 image.png 一、域名重定向怎么解决?...域名重定向是常见的问题,这里需要运用到专业知识,人们若是在打开网站时看到需要“域名重定向”几个字,依据经验判断问题出在系统文件“hosts”已经遭到损坏,此时就要删除电脑部分内容或对hosts文件进行复原...,具体做法是打开电脑,输入C盘路径进入到系统文件夹找到hosts文件,右键双击用记事本打开它,将这些相关内容通通删掉,尝试再次打开网站,会发现大多数文件内容已经恢复正常了,若是以上操作军未能解决问题,再利用其他...出现域名重定向的原因是各种各样的,域名重定向怎么解决需要认真学习,有些用户在建立网站之初,并没有对域名方面的知识进行全方位了解,就会遇到许多意料之外的问题,建议公司聘请有专业经验的网络设计维护人员,从构建网站框架到填充网站内容...以上就是有关域名重定向怎么解决的内容,域名建设是非常专业的一块内容,许多人在遇到网站提示域名重定向时,都会感到非常的无助,其实这样的问题很常见,只要耐心沉着地去解决就可以了,同时要总结相关经验,在网站维护的时候要更加细心

    4.1K30

    电脑进入系统后黑屏怎么解决

    电脑开机直接黑屏是怎么回事: 1.先看看显示器电源是否接通,若接通,则看看你的显示器开关是否打开; 2.再看看主机电源指示灯是否亮,不亮则考虑你的电源可能坏了,如亮则听听主机通电后的声音,如果很清脆的一声...电脑黑屏故障解决方法: (1)如果换另外显示器电脑正常启动,那么原显示器可能损坏; (2)系统是否安装软件和更新补丁,如有请卸载更新文件; (3)电脑安装软件后重启正在更新导致黑屏,等待更新完毕即可;...(4)检查显示器电缆是否牢固可靠地插入到主机接口,再检查显卡与主板I/O插槽之间的接触是否良好; (5)可进安全模式修复电脑,如果不能进安全模式,请重新安装系统; (6)检查电脑CPU风扇是否运转; (...若电脑依然黑屏,则建议更换主板 电脑开机黑屏解决方法: 1.启动计算机时,在系统进入 Windows 启动画面前,按下 F8 键;出现操作系统多模式启动菜单后,用键盘上的方向键选择“SafeMode”

    4.2K10

    BI系统存在哪些问题,怎么解决

    BI系统大概的架构 在BI系统里面,核心的模块是Cube,Cube是一个更高层的业务模型抽象,在Cube之上可以进行多种操作,大部分BI系统都基于关系型数据库,关系型数据库使用SQL语句进行操作。...BI系统存在的问题 BI系统更多的以分析业务数据产生的密度高、价值高的结构化数据为主,对于非结构化和半结构化数据的处理非常乏力; 由于数据仓库为结构化存储,在数据从其他系统进入数据仓库,叫做ETL过程...要解析数据内容进入数据仓库,则需要非常复杂等ETL程序,从而导致ETL变得过于庞大和臃肿; 当数据量过大的时候,性能会成为瓶颈,在TB/PB级别的数据量上表现出明显的吃力; 数据库的范式等约束规则,着力于解决数据冗余的问题...Hadoop大数据分析平台出现 侧重从以下几个维度去解决做数据分析面临的瓶颈: 分布式计算: 思路是让多个节点并行计算,并且强调数据本地性,尽可能的减少数据的传输; 分布式存储: 分布式存储是指将一个大文件拆成

    1.4K10

    手机短信删除了怎么恢复?这里有解决方法

    手机短信删除了怎么恢复?现在手机里的短信还会有多少人在乎呢?...现在虽然收到的短信都会有很多,不过大部分的内容都是一些小广告之类的短信纯属于垃圾短信,前面不怎么会影响,但是累计起来的短信就会有很多了,此时就想去删除一些手机的短信,但是一不小心删除了手机中重要短信怎么办...手机短信删除了怎么恢复?...一:手机短信中的回收站   如今手机发展的越来越迅速了,照片删除了在手机的相册中有最近删除这样的一个功能存在,当然现在有些手机中也有回收站这样的功能,短信删除一般会暂存在回收站里面,找到短信回收站之后找到删除的短信恢复就可以了...手机短信删除了怎么恢复?以上的简单方法就可以轻松将删除的短信恢复出来了,做好手机备份是很有必要的操作。

    1.6K10

    【已解决】Windows系统使用WSL安装的Linux系统怎么设置root密码

    在前面两篇文章:《【图文教程】Windows11下安装Docker Desktop》及《Windos11下通过WSL安装centos7系统》我们已经在自己的Windows系统上安装了CentOS7系统。...然后使用powerShell可以直接连接到CentOS系统中。 不知道大家有没有发现,powerShell直接就连接上了。没有让我们输入用户名和密码。是不是很神奇?...那么这种情况下,怎么修改root密码呢?分以下两种情况。 情况一:如果在安装的时候,没用创建root用户,那么可以使用如下命令,直接修改密码。...然后在进入操作系统的时候,使用的用户,就是root用户了。如上图。进入root用户后,就可以以root用户身份修改密码了。 请注意,这里的kali是kali操作系统。...如果是CentOS系统的话,将kali修改成CentOS

    9K10

    系统之家重装 笔记本开机没反应怎么解决

    系统之家重装 笔记本开机没反应怎么解决 用户在使用笔记本的过程中,会遇到按了开机键,笔记本电脑没有任何反应,也就是按开关键后指示灯不亮,听听风扇没有转动的声音,笔记本电脑没有一点反应。...这,这,这,该怎么解决呢?下面,就来跟大家分享解决笔记本开机没反应的经验。...开机没反应图-6 3、如果故障依旧,使用系统盘修复,打开命令提示符输入SFC /SCANNOW 回车,SFC和/之间有一个空格,插入原装系统盘修复系统系统会自动对比修复的。...开机图-7 4、如果故障依旧,在BIOS中设置光驱为第一启动设备插入系统安装盘按R键选择“修复安装” 开机图-8 以上就是解决笔记本开机没反应的操作了。...转:系统之家重装 笔记本开机没反应怎么解决(xtzjcz.com)

    1.4K30

    电脑无法加域,ping域名显示为公网IP,这是什么问题?怎么解决

    众所周知,电脑要加域,必须能正确地解析域名,但是客户说,新电脑ping域名却显示为公网IP,导致电脑无法加域。听到这种问题,第一反应就是DNS的问题。...究竟是DNS Server的问题,还是电脑DNS Client的问题,其实很好判断,只要别的电脑ping域名能正常解析到内网域控IP,则表示DNS Server根本没问题。...远程登录客户的新电脑,发现IP和DNS服务器配置无误,ping域名确实还是显示为公网IP。...此时,ping域名则显示为内网域控的IP,操作加域成功。...其实,这是个很小的问题,我当时上线解决问题,也就是二三十秒的时间,但是有些网管会走进死胡同,总认为是DNS服务器的故障,或者干脆不知道从何查起,所以特此分享。

    4.1K10
    领券